Cleaning the body
2. PRECAUTIONS

English
• Use a soft, dry cloth and gently wipe off any dirt or dust.
• For tough dirt, apply some neutral detergent diluted in water to a soft cloth, wipe off the dirt
gently, then wipe again with a dry cloth.

1) Before Starting

1. This set is exclusively for use in cars with a 5) Installing the Source Unit
negative ground 12 V power supply.
2. Read these instructions carefully.
1. Place the mounting bracket into the instrument panel, use a screwdriver to bend
3. Be sure to disconnect the battery “terminal” before
each stopper of the mounting bracket inward, then secure the stopper.
starting. This is to prevent short circuits during
2. Wire as shown in Section 7) .
installation. (Figure 1) Car battery 3. Insert the source unit into the mounting bracket until it locks.

8) Connecting the Accessories

• Connecting to the external amplifier


External amplifiers can be connected to the 4 channel RCA output connections.
Ensure that the connectors are not grounded or shorted to prevent damage to the
unit.
